Question

An ideal gas undergoes a thermodynamic process described by the equation: PV2=CPV^2 = C, where CC is a constant. The gas transitions from an initial state (P1,V1,T1)(P_1, V_1, T_1) to a final state (P2,V2,T2)(P_2, V_2, T_2). Which of the following statements is correct?

A

If P1>P2P_1 > P_2, then T1<T2T_1 < T_2

B

If V2>V1V_2 > V_1, then T2>T1T_2 > T_1

C

If V2>V1V_2 > V_1, then T2<T1T_2 < T_1

D

If P1>P2P_1 > P_2, then V1>V2V_1 > V_2
